The Hurrem Sultan Hammam in Istanbul is a famous place that must be visited. It was built for the beloved wife of Sultan Suleiman and now it is one of the most visited places. Inside, the building impresses with its size and beauty. There you will be washed in soapy water, steamed on warm marble slabs, then given an aromatic massage and finally treated to a delicious, fragrant Turkish tea with baklava. I definitely recommend you to visit, the Premium service category, the hammam is really 16th century, everything is restored inside. Steam room in white marble, massage rooms and changing rooms made of wood. In the steam rooms and locker rooms, everything is practically sterile, which is an indicator for such establishments ... Separate entrance for men and women. The program for 1.5 hours, steaming, washing and massage is about 200 Euros per person, if you are in a group, you can easily get a discount of 10-15%. Towels, flip-flops, disposable linen, everything is given out. There are safes for money/phones inside, shooting inside is prohibited. At the exit, they give you a gift of branded soap and a massage glove.
